What is Evolution?
Evolution is the process that results in inheritable traits changing over time in a group of people. This change is a result of natural selection along with other processes, such as genetic drift. This results in some genes becoming more prevalent while others become less frequent. These changes could result in the creation of new species. Evolution is also known as natural selection or the "survival of the fittest". It is not the Creationism that affirms that God created everything.
The term "evolution" refers to "change over time." While certain of these changes are large some are minor and inaccessible outside of a lab. All of these changes contribute towards the growth of biodiversity. These changes are occurring at all levels and sizes of life, from single-celled organisms to large creatures such as humans.

Evolution is a process of change
The process of evolution is by the traits that are inherited in biological populations change over generations. It can happen at any level of biological organization, from genes to species. All living things have evolved from the common ancestor. Evolution can be seen as a series natural changes that cause species, to emerge, to adjust to their environment and to eventually die out.
The source of evolution is morphology, physiology, and behavior. They can be altered through selection against or for and are passed to future generations. Selection can be artificial or natural. Natural selection is the primary mechanism for evolution. It works by preserving valuable mutations and eliminating harmful ones. In this way, beneficial genetic variations are accumulated and new species develop.
Mutations can either be beneficial or harmful for an organism. They can also alter how genes are expressed, which affects the appearance and behavior of a person or animal. Mutations can result from errors in DNA replication or repair. They can also be caused by radiation damage or chemical manipulation. The results are known as alleles and they can be passed on from parent to offspring.
Alleles can be passed down at different frequencies among different members of a group. Scientists examine these changes by studying the frequency of alleles in the population. By comparing the frequencies of alleles over a period of time, they can determine the evolution rate in the population. It is important to keep in mind that evolution takes place in a collective and not in an individual.

Evolution is a theory
The theory of evolution has been well-supported by science throughout the ages. It is supported by a wide range of scientific disciplines including genetics and paleontology. The theory is based on the idea that all species are connected and that their characteristics have changed over time. Furthermore it is based on the observation that individuals within the same species aren't identical and that some of these differences are due the genetic influences.
The term "evolution," originally, was used to describe a series of changes species were predetermined to go through similar to how an embryo was preprogrammed to develop. Such views were popularized by Jean Baptiste de Lamarck, Erasmus Darwin (Charles's grandfather), Etienne Geoffroy Saint-Hilaire and Robert Chambers, who wrote the Vestiges of Creation in 1844. Charles Lyell, who wrote Principles of Geology in 1833, criticised these views and used the term evolution to describe natural changes in species over time.

The current meaning of evolution is based on the fact that individuals within the same species aren't identical and that some of the differences are due to their genetics. In addition the changes that happen in a group are influenced by the environment, and are based on natural selection. For instance If a person is born with resistance to illness is more likely to survive and reproduce. In turn, their genetic traits will be passed on to the next generation.
This process is known as natural selection, and is a key element of the theory of evolution.
